dove posso trovare i log di mysql (errori, query, ecc.) Nell'interfaccia phpmyadmin?dove posso trovare i log di mysql in phpmyadmin?
risposta
Aprire PHPMyAdmin, non selezionare alcun database e cercare la scheda Binary Log
. È possibile selezionare registri diversi da un elenco a discesa e premere il pulsante GO
per visualizzarli.
Se si utilizza XAMPP come server, si troverà una directory dei registri come figlio della directory XAMPP. Se non hai provato XAMPP, che gira su qualsiasi sistema (Windows, Mac OS & Linux) trova più qui: http://www.apachefriends.org/en/xampp.html
ho avuto lo stesso problema di @rutherford, oggi 3.4.11.1 GUI del nuovo phpMyAdmin è diverso, così Capisco che è meglio se qualcuno migliora le risposte con informazioni aggiornate. log di MySQL completi possono essere trovati in:
"Stato" -> "Binary Log"
questa è la risposta, non importa se si sta utilizzando MAMP, XAMPP, LAMP, ecc.
In phpMyAdmin 4.0, si passa a Stato> Monitor. Qui puoi abilitare il log delle query lente e il log generale, vedere un monitor live, selezionare una parte del grafico, vedere le query correlate e analizzarle.
Sto usando phpMyAdmin versione 4.2.11. Al momento della scrittura, la mia scheda Status
assomiglia a questo (alcune opzioni espansi; notare "le impostazioni correnti", in basso a destra):
Nota non ci sono direttamente visibili "caratteristiche" che permettono di l'abilitazione di cose come slow_query_log
. Quindi, sono andato a scavare su internet perché le risposte orientate all'UI saranno rilevanti solo per una particolare release e, quindi, diventeranno rapidamente obsolete. Quindi, che cosa fa se si non si veda una risposta pertinente, sopra?
Come questo article explains, è possibile eseguire una query globale per abilitare o disabilitare lo slow_query_log
e altri. Le query per abilitare e disabilitare questi registri non sono difficili, quindi non aver paura di loro, ad es.
SET GLOBAL slow_query_log = 'ON';
Da qui, phpMyAdmin è abbastanza utile e un po 'di usare Google ti porterà fino a velocità in pochissimo tempo. Per esempio, dopo aver eseguito la query di cui sopra, posso tornare al "/ istruzioni di configurazione" opzione sotto la finestra Monitor
della scheda Stato e vedere questo (nota le ulteriori istruzioni):
ho Database, Schede SQL, Stato, Variabili, Set di caratteri, Motori, Processi, Esportazione e importazione ma nessun 'Registro binario' - sto cercando nella posizione corretta? – rutherford
HUmm, ho privilegi e log binari tra motori e processi. stai usando WAMP? Quale versione? Sei collegato con root? –
ah, probabilmente limitato dai miei padroni allora. Chiederò loro, grazie per il vostro aiuto. – rutherford